### Fan-out backpressure (Heraldix notifier)

When downstream push workers fall behind, the fan-out stage sheds load by collapsing duplicate notifications per recipient and pausing intake once queue depth crosses a threshold. Maintainers should prefer adjusting the pause/resume watermarks over raising worker counts, since the bottleneck is usually the delivery gateway. The current watermarks and limits follow.

tuning table, fawip-fahag:
WEIGHTS = {
    "novwyn": 452,
    "casdor": 675,
}

Ticket DRIFT-providence: The Marrowline diff viewer for large files is behaving differently across the Selda fleet. Chunking thresholds on three nodes no longer match the baseline, so diffs over 200 MB render inline on some hosts and stream on others, confusing customers. Support should confirm which behavior a reporter sees before escalating. For reference, the intended baseline configuration is as follows.

service settings:
[quenath]
host = quenath.zemvarcorp.corp
user = quenath_svc
database = quenath_prod

Subject: Key rotation — Pathfern deep-link router

Welcome aboard. This week we rotated credentials for Pathfern, the service that resolves mobile deep links to in-app routes. Since you'll be testing link handling on both platforms, please update your local config before running the routing harness; the old key is already revoked. The staging endpoint and route map are in the onboarding doc. The new key for Pathfern is below.

API key for yahig-tadup: kto7_ubizbYm

## Service Account: graphscope-renderer

Welcome aboard. The dependency graph visualizer, Graphscope, runs under the `svc-graphscope` account. It crawls every repository manifest nightly, resolves the full dependency tree, and renders interactive graphs for the platform dashboard. As a contractor, you have read access to its output but should not modify the crawler schedule without approval from the platform lead.

To run the renderer locally against the manifest index service, it must authenticate with the key below.

app token of yahif-fahap = vxb3-3pr